The rules of online discovery are changing. For years, businesses focused almost exclusively on Search Engine Optimization (SEO) to attract customers through Google. Today, however, consumers are increasingly finding answers through AI assistants, conversational search, and generative platforms.

This shift has introduced new concepts like Answer Engine Optimization (AEO) and Generative Engine Optimization (GEO). While these terms sound similar, they serve different purposes—and understanding the differences could determine which ecommerce brands thrive in the next decade.


Search has evolved through three major phases:

EraPrimary GoalUser BehaviorOptimization Focus
SEO EraRank on search enginesUser searches keywords and clicks linksRankings, backlinks, keywords
AEO EraBecome the answerUser asks questions and expects direct answersFAQs, structured content, snippets
GEO EraBecome part of AI-generated responsesUser interacts with AI assistants and conversational searchAuthority, entities, structured knowledge, AI visibility

Rather than replacing one another, SEO, AEO, and GEO build upon each other.

Think of them as layers rather than competitors.


What is SEO?

Search Engine Optimization

SEO is the practice of improving a website's visibility within traditional search engines like Google and Bing.

The goal is straightforward:

Rank as high as possible for relevant search queries.

Common SEO Activities

  • Keyword research
  • Content creation
  • Backlink building
  • Technical SEO
  • Site speed optimization
  • Internal linking
  • Metadata optimization

Example

A wine retailer may target:

best wine storage racks

or

wall mounted wine racks

The goal is to appear near the top of Google's search results.

Strengths of SEO

StrengthDetails
Proven channelDecades of documented ROI across industries
High intent trafficUsers actively searching for products/solutions
Long-term compounding returnsContent continues generating traffic over time
Critical for ecommerce growthDirect correlation between organic visibility and revenue

Limitations of SEO

LimitationImpact
Increasing competitionMore brands competing for the same keywords
Lower click-through ratesAI summaries reducing clicks to websites
Reliance on search engine rankingsAlgorithm changes can disrupt traffic overnight
Users seeking answers without clickingZero-click searches growing year over year

What is AEO?

Answer Engine Optimization

AEO focuses on helping your content become the direct answer to a user's question.

Instead of simply ranking for keywords, AEO aims to help search engines and AI-powered answer systems quickly identify and present your content as the best response.

Example

Instead of targeting:

Shopify AI

You optimize for:

What is Shopify MCP?

or

How do AI agents work with Shopify?

These are the kinds of questions that AI assistants are now answering directly — making AEO essential for brands that want to remain visible.

Common AEO Techniques

  • FAQ sections
  • Direct answer paragraphs
  • Structured headings
  • Schema markup
  • How-to content
  • Question-and-answer formatting

What AEO Looks Like in Practice

ScenarioTraditional SEOAEO
User query"best ecommerce automation tools""What are the best ecommerce automation tools?"
Result formatList of ranked linksDirect answer displayed immediately
User actionClicks a resultReads the answer without clicking
Brand visibilityDepends on ranking positionDepends on being the selected answer

Why AEO Matters

Search engines increasingly provide answers without requiring users to click through to websites.

This creates a new challenge:

If your content isn't answer-ready, it may never be seen.

What is GEO?

Generative Engine Optimization

GEO is the newest evolution.

Instead of optimizing for search engines or answer boxes, GEO focuses on helping AI systems understand, trust, and reference your brand.

This includes platforms such as:

  • ChatGPT
  • Gemini
  • Claude
  • Perplexity
  • Copilot
  • Future AI shopping assistants

GEO Is Different

Optimization LayerCore Question
Traditional SEOHow do I rank?
AEOHow do I become the answer?
GEOHow do I become part of the AI-generated response?

Example

A user asks ChatGPT:

What are the best ways to optimize a Shopify store for AI search?

The AI generates a response using information gathered from multiple sources.

The goal of GEO is to increase the likelihood that:

  • Your brand is mentioned
  • Your content is referenced
  • Your expertise influences the answer

GEO Relies on Authority, Not Just Keywords

AI systems evaluate much more than keyword matching.

GEO Signals

SignalImportanceWhy It Matters
Topical AuthorityHighAI trusts brands that demonstrate deep expertise
Structured DataHighSchema helps AI understand content relationships
Internal LinkingHighConnected content signals comprehensive knowledge
Brand MentionsHighCross-platform presence reinforces legitimacy
Content DepthHighThorough coverage signals expertise
ConsistencyHighRegular publishing builds trust over time
BacklinksModerateStill valuable but less dominant than in SEO
Exact Match KeywordsLower than traditional SEOAI understands context beyond exact phrases

AI systems care more about:

  • Expertise
  • Context
  • Relationships between topics
  • Knowledge structure

than simple keyword repetition.

Visual Framework: SEO vs AEO vs GEO

LayerGoalOutcome
SEOGet FoundVisibility in search results
AEOGet AnsweredContent selected as the direct answer
GEOGet ReferencedBrand mentioned in AI-generated responses

Or stated differently:

LayerOne-Word Summary
SEOVisibility
AEOClarity
GEOAuthority

Practical GEO Checklist for Ecommerce Brands

Content

ActionPriorityEffort
Create topic clustersHighMedium
Publish educational contentHighOngoing
Answer customer questions directlyHighLow
Develop resource hubsMediumHigh

Technical Foundation

ActionPriorityEffort
Implement schema markupVery HighMedium
Improve internal linkingHighLow
Maintain clean site architectureHighMedium
Build knowledge centersMediumHigh

Authority Building

ActionPriorityEffort
Publish consistentlyVery HighOngoing
Earn mentions across platformsHighOngoing
Demonstrate expertiseHighMedium
Build topical depthVery HighHigh
